The torsion of a curve defined by r(t) \mathbf { r } ( t ) is given by
τ=(rt×rtt) rtttrt×rtt2\tau = \frac { \left( \mathbf { r } ^ { t } \times \mathbf { r } ^ { tt } \right) \cdot \mathbf { r } ^ {ttt } } { \left| \mathbf { r } ^ { t } \times \mathbf { r } ^ { t t } \right| ^ { 2 } } Find the torsion of the curve defined by r(t) =cos5ti+sin5tj+4tkr ( t ) = \cos 5 t \mathbf { i } + \sin 5 t \mathbf { j } + 4 t \mathbf { k } .
